Dr. Marius Saines is a vascular surgeon practicing in Marina Del Rey, CA. Dr. Saines specializes in disorders relating to the arterial, venous and lymphatic systems. As a vascular surgeon, Dr. Saines diagnoses and treats vascular diseases and performs vasular surgeries. Common conditions that a vascular surgeon treats are aneurysms, atherosclerosis and varicose veins. Vascular specialists might also treat trauma, venous ulcers, poor leg circulation, peripheral arterial disease and other vascular-related issues.
